Kito Muñoz photographs a fun story for the pages of the British fashion magazine HERO. Muñoz collaborates with stylist Luca Guarini for the occasion. Meanwhile, models Fernando Lindez, Mario Lopez, and Oscar Kindelan are cast into the spotlight. Guarini adopts the style philosophy of naughty and nice as he pulls together bold menswear options. Sporting varied brands, such as Prada, Givenchy, Louis Vuitton, Fernando, Mario, and Oscar, are luxurious standouts. The models don everything from leather gloves and pinstripe suiting to indigo blue denim. Ready for the camera, the models, rock an extra glow as Muñoz ensures that the light hits them just right.
